Results
1 results found

Lavender Tea Rooms and The Oldest Chemists Shop in England in the Market Place at Knaresborough, Knaresborough, Yorkshire, England, United Kingdom, Europe

Laboratory examination with laboratory apparatus and monitor, evaluation of a laboratory examination with chemist in the laboratory, Freiburg, Baden-Wuerttemberg, Germany, Europe